They did lower the amount of gym fights

Obviously Niantic has lowered the amount of necessery gym fights to defeat a pokemon. You don't have to fight 5 or 6 times anymore. After 3 times a fully motivated mon faints.

That's good news because it was so boring to fight against the same weak mon again and again and again...
